RDM GROUP HAS COMMUNICATED TODAY ITS INTENTION TO CLOSE THE MILL IN CASTELLBISBAL, SPAIN

15-01-2025

The Group is forced to take this difficult decision due to increasingly challenging market conditions, including a shift in consumption patterns, inflationary pressures in Europe and a challenging geopolitical environment exacerbated by the Russia-Ukraine conflict.

These factors, combined with a significant drop in European cartonboard demand between 2021 and 2023, have led to accumulated stocks in the value chain and therefore very low mill capacity utilization rates.

 

In Iberia the demand has sharply decreased. This context particularly impacts the Castellbisbal Mill.

 

RDM Group will continue to operate in Iberia through Paprinsa Mill in Mollerussa, that has greater flexibility options which enable RDM Group to strengthen competitiveness and better adapt to the current and future expected sector’s dynamics. The Group will cover market demand through Paprinsa and other mills in the group for special products.

MICHELE BIANCHI APPOINTED PRESIDENT OF FIBRE PACKAGING EUROPE

RDM Group is pleased to announce that Michele Bianchi, CEO of the Group, has been appointed President of Fibre Packaging Europe (FPE), the coalition that brings together seven European trade associations representing the entire fibre‑based packaging value chain. FPE represents around 1,500 companies, 2,200 manufacturing sites, 365,000 employees, and generates more than EUR 120 billion in annual turnover.
